Which Audio Interfaces Are Best For Beginners?

Beginners usually benefit most from audio interfaces that are affordable, easy to set up, and simple to operate. Look for models with one or two inputs, USB connectivity, direct monitoring, and reliable driver support. These features make recording vocals, instruments, podcasts, or livestreams much easier without adding unnecessary complexity. Many starter options also include recording software, helping new creators begin producing content immediately. While premium models offer more advanced capabilities, entry-level audio interfaces often provide excellent sound quality and enough flexibility for learning, practicing, and creating professional-sounding projects from the comfort of home.

What Is The Difference Between One-Channel And Two-Channel Audio Interfaces?

The main difference is how many audio sources you can record at the same time. One-channel audio interfaces are ideal for solo creators recording a single microphone or instrument, making them a budget-friendly choice. Two-channel models allow two microphones, instruments, or a combination of both to be recorded simultaneously, making them better for interviews, duets, podcasts, and music sessions. If you expect your recording needs to grow, a two-channel interface offers greater flexibility without a significant increase in cost, making it a practical long-term investment for many creators.

Which Audio Interfaces Work Best For Podcasting?

The best audio interfaces for podcasting offer clean microphone preamps, low-latency monitoring, and dependable USB connectivity. If you record solo, a single-input model is often enough. For interviews or co-hosted shows, choose an interface with at least two microphone inputs. Features like 48V phantom power, headphone monitoring, and bundled recording software can also improve your workflow. Reliable audio interfaces help capture clear voices with minimal background noise, making editing easier and giving your audience a more professional listening experience without requiring a complicated recording setup.

Which Audio Interfaces Are Best For Music Production?

The best audio interfaces for music production combine excellent sound quality, low latency, and enough inputs to match your recording needs. Solo artists may only need one or two inputs, while bands and producers often benefit from additional connections for multiple instruments and microphones. High-resolution recording, reliable drivers, direct monitoring, and MIDI support are also valuable features. Choosing audio interfaces with room to grow allows you to expand your studio over time while maintaining consistent recording quality for vocals, instruments, and full production projects.
